## What is the Algorithm of Universal Lambda Input?

Universal Lambda Input represents a parameterized function utilized within quantitative financial modeling, specifically for generating stochastic volatility surfaces applicable to cryptocurrency options and derivatives pricing. Its core function involves mapping a set of input parameters – lambda – to a volatility skew, enabling dynamic adjustment of implied volatility across different strike prices and maturities. This algorithmic approach facilitates the calibration of option pricing models to observed market data, improving the accuracy of risk assessment and hedging strategies in volatile digital asset markets.

## What is the Application of Universal Lambda Input?

The practical application of Universal Lambda Input extends to real-time options pricing, portfolio optimization, and the construction of synthetic derivatives within the cryptocurrency space. Traders and quantitative analysts leverage this input to model the impact of market events on option values, informing decisions related to trade execution and risk mitigation. Furthermore, it serves as a crucial component in automated trading systems and algorithmic strategies designed to capitalize on mispricings in the options market, enhancing capital efficiency.

## What is the Calculation of Universal Lambda Input?

The calculation underpinning Universal Lambda Input typically involves a series of mathematical transformations applied to the lambda parameters, often employing splines or other interpolation techniques to create a smooth volatility surface. Precise calibration requires robust statistical methods, such as maximum likelihood estimation, to minimize the difference between model-predicted prices and actual market prices. Consequently, the accuracy of the calculation is directly linked to the quality of the input data and the sophistication of the underlying mathematical framework.
